    Will Tarik Skubal Pitch Again At the 2026 World Baseball Classic?

    Has Tarik Skubal thrown his last pitch for Team USA at the 2026 World Baseball Classic?

    The Detroit Tigers ace went three full innings in the United States’ rout of Great Britain in pool play on Saturday at Daikin Park in Houston. He was retired after 41 pitches, five strikeouts, two hits allowed and one run earned.

    Following his start vs. Great Britain, Skubal left the door open for another appearance, telling FOX Sports’ Ken Rosenthal that it was “a tough question right now.” But according to Team USA manager Mark DeRosa, Skubal’s World Baseball Classic will conclude on Monday, following the United States’ rivalry game against Mexico.

    Skubal tempered expectations for his time at the World Baseball Classic when asked about it in February.

    “The reason I didn’t announce it (sooner) was I wanted to keep the momentum on the WBC, but I’m just making one start and then I’ll stick around for a few games,” Skubal told reporters. “I haven’t determined what games I’m going to watch.

    “If they go to the finals, I think I’m going to try and lobby to just go watch and be with the guys. But yeah, I’m just making one start and getting back on track and getting back to here.”

    Before his start, Skubal also discussed his long-term future with the Tigers. The two-time AL Cy Young winner won his $32 million arbitration case this season amid talks of a potential new deal.

    “There is no offer,” Skubal told USA Today Sports, “and there won’t be an offer until the end of the season. … My focus is on playing baseball and winning this year. I’ll deal with the contract stuff at the end of the year, and then we’ll kind of see. And that’s fine. It’s their decision.”

    Even without Skubal, the rotation that the USA has assembled is still the best in the tournament. The Americans used San Francisco Giants ace Logan Webb in Friday’s win over Brazil. They’ll use reigning NL Cy Young Award winner Paul Skenes on Monday night against Mexico.

    Assuming the USA advances from Pool B, they will play a quarterfinal game either March 13 or 14, with either game in Houston. The semifinals are March 15 and 16 before the championship game on March 17, with those rounds in Miami.
